I have a Toro 5700D with a raven scs 440 and I haven't changed anything about how I spray....gpa is the same, all numbers entered into the Raven controller are the same, etc. The last couple times I have sprayed greens the rate jumps to find my gpa on the first pass of the green. After the first pass it typically will hold the correct rate until I travel to the next green and then the process starts all over again. Everything mechanical seems to be working properly: pump, high pressure discharge valve, agitators, boom hoses, nozzles, diaphragms, etc. Ending rate seems to come out close to normal considering the jumping. This makes me think that at least the majority of the time the flow meter is ok. In manual, the pressure will adjust but also has psi holding issues. This happens when using the floor switch to turn on booms or when using individual boom switches on console. Any ideas?
